Output 750dd768c9f4d8ee0a0b81def2f22dc78ad5d87924b208580a0ffe20cf4adb72:1

value
38894
script pubkey
OP_0 OP_PUSHBYTES_20 8ee37d49aa622ae4a5334a3271f101e2c733309b
address
tb1q3m3h6jd2vg4wfffnfge8rugputrnxvymy7hyxk
transaction
750dd768c9f4d8ee0a0b81def2f22dc78ad5d87924b208580a0ffe20cf4adb72
confirmations
44997
spent
true